Major Cyber Attack on Jaguar Land Rover: Impacts on the Auto Industry
In an alarming development for the automotive sector, a recent report has revealed that a significant cyber attack on Jaguar Land Rover was orchestrated by Russian hackers, resulting in losses exceeding $2.5 billion. This breach not only underscores vulnerabilities within large corporations but also serves as a wake-up call for the entire auto parts industry as it navigates an increasingly digital landscape.
The Scale of the Attack
Last year, Jaguar Land Rover experienced one of the most damaging cyber incidents in recent memory. The breach disrupted production lines, delayed deliveries, and compromised sensitive customer data, all while incurring substantial financial losses. Such a significant attack has sparked concerns about the security protocols in place at automotive manufacturers and suppliers alike.
Financial Implications
The total financial impact is staggering. With losses estimated at $2.5 billion, the ramifications of this cyber attack extend far beyond immediate financial concerns. These costs include:
- Loss of revenue from halted production and delayed sales.
- Costly recovery efforts and investments in enhanced cybersecurity measures.
- Potential legal repercussions and liability claims from customers and partners.
As these figures suggest, the automotive industry must reassess its cybersecurity frameworks to prevent future incidents.

Connected Vehicles and Cybersecurity Risks
As manufacturers race to incorporate more advanced technologies such as IoT devices and cloud computing, they inadvertently create new avenues for cyber threats. Common vulnerabilities include:
- Insecure communication channels that can be exploited by hackers.
- Insufficient encryption measures for sensitive data.
- Third-party vendor risks that may compromise systems.
This evolving threat landscape necessitates a robust and proactive approach to cybersecurity.

Best Practices for Auto Parts Manufacturers
Auto parts manufacturers must also adapt to this changing environment. Here are some recommended best practices:
- Implementing multi-factor authentication for access to sensitive systems.
- Conducting regular employee training on cybersecurity awareness.
- Engaging in frequent security assessments and penetration testing.
By prioritizing cybersecurity, manufacturers can mitigate the risks associated with potential breaches and safeguard their operations.
